Wireless sensor network
Method:
Summary:
Radio frequency used:
Radio protocol used:
Range/Power (line of sight/dBm):
with line of sight: several km (2.4 GHz and 915 MHz) (868 MHz planned and GPRS in development (beta version)
Hop modes:
enhanced single hop (base station and relay permanently online)
GPRS:
in development
Mesh limitations:
number of sensors: 5
number of nodes per router:
Additional information:
Sensor compatibility:
all Decagon (analog, digital, pulse) other sensors possible
Data reading frequency:
1 minute
Storage of data/backup:
36’864 data places
Power consumption:
60 – 70 mAh base station 60 – 70 mAh relay average for sensor unit: less than 1 mAh
Reliability:
years in service: 6 – 7 year (life time of product line)
Installation procedure:
easy
Installation underground possible:
not possible
Battery life:
6-8 months typically
Maintenance required /Ease of maintenance:
easy
Support:
possible and easy
Software:
local database, web friendly interface planned desktop software for visualization, scripting not needed black box system
Cost:
What to watch out for:
Problems/Questions:
humidity problems may be possible due to “open” casing
